Best 55921 Minnesota Private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 2 private schools serving 212 students in 55921, MN (there are 4 public schools, serving 742 public students). 22% of all K-12 students in 55921, MN are educated in private schools (compared to the MN state average of 10%).
The average acceptance rate is 100%, which is higher than the Minnesota private school average acceptance rate of 91%.
100% of private schools in 55921, MN are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ic and Wisconsin Evangelical Lutheran Synod).
